OfficeJet Pro 9015e

Looking for info from current OfficeJet Pro 9015e printer users. Is this printer compatible with HP eprint? Are you able to send emails to your printers email address and have them print out? Can you change the HP eprint settings when you sign into HP App and select your 9015e printer? Literally everything else works perfectly on my 09015e but for the life of me I can't get sending emails to my printers email address to work. I know it's reachable from the internet because when I am away from home I can print files to it using the HP app but when I send emails to the printers email address I get the confirmation email saying the job was sent to the printer but nothing ever prints. It's like something is not connected/configured correctly and the print job never gets from the HP cloud to my printer. When I go to the HP support site and try going thru the steps listed for HP eprint I don't have any of the eprint configuration screens that are listed when I look at my 9015e printer.

Is it possible that 9015e printers don't actually support hp eprint and the capability to send emails to the printer using the printers email address?
